Compare all specifications:
1996 BMW 840 | 1962 Nissan Bluebird | |
Make | BMW | Nissan |
Model | 840 | Bluebird |
Year Released | 1996 | 1962 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 3982 cc | 1189 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 4 valves | 2 valves |
Horse Power | 282 HP | 53 HP |
Engine RPM | 5800 RPM | 4800 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Vehicle Weight | 1740 kg | 900 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4790 mm | 3920 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1860 mm | 1500 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1350 mm | 1480 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2690 mm | 2290 mm |
